**CDN回源策略优化建议**,CDN的回源策略对网站性能和用户体验至关重要,建议根据业务需求及流量模式优化,优先使用源站缓存,减轻服务器压力,采用多级缓存体系,如缓存集群与边缘节点缓存,减少数据传输延迟并提高访问速度,动态内容与非动态内容分开处理,优化缓存规则,实时监控回源状况并及时调整策略,也是提升CDN使用效率的关键,这些措施可显著提升网站响应速度,保障用户观看高清流畅视频,同时降低维护成本。
随着互联网的快速发展,内容分发网络(CDN)已经成为网站性能优化的重要手段,CDN通过将静态资源缓存在离用户最近的节点上,有效减少了数据传输时间,提升了用户访问速度,在实际应用中,CDN回源策略往往存在一些问题,如流量过大、请求延迟高等,本文将对CDN回源策略进行优化建议,助力网站更好地服务用户。
CDN回源策略概述
CDN回源策略是指将动态生成的网页内容或数据从源站直接返回给用户,而非通过CDN节点进行缓存和分发,这样可以降低回源成本,提高页面响应速度,常见的回源策略包括:基于HTTP Referrer头的回源、基于URL路径的回源以及基于IP地址的回源等。
CDN回源策略优化建议
合理设置回源源站
- 根据业务需求选择合适的源站,尽量将静态资源放在源站,避免将动态内容和大量数据放在源站,以减轻源站的负担。
- 对于规模较小的网站,可以考虑将源站与CDN节点部署在同一地域,以减少网络传输距离和时间。
优化HTTP Referrer策略
- 使用自定义的Referrer策略,仅将动态内容的请求返回到CDN节点,对于静态资源和页眉页脚信息等不需要实时更新的页面元素,可以选择不携带Referrer信息进行回源。
- 利用Referer策略的有效性和准确性,可以更精确地识别用户的真实来源,并据此调整回源策略。
采用多级回源架构
- 根据业务特点,可以采用多级回源架构,包括边缘节点回源、区域回源、全国回源和全球回源等,以便实现更加精细化的流量分配和请求路由。
实施智能DNS解析
- 利用智能DNS解析技术,根据用户的网络环境和地理位置等因素,动态地将DNS解析指向离用户最近的CDN节点,以实现更为精准的内容分发。
强化回源监控与预警
- 完善回源流量、延迟和错误率等关键指标的监控机制,并设置合理的告警阈值,确保在出现问题时能够及时发现并采取相应措施。
CDN回源策略优化是网站性能提升的关键环节,通过合理设置回源源站、优化HTTP Referrer策略、采用多级回源架构、实施智能DNS解析以及强化回源监控与预警等措施的实施和不断调整优化将极大地改善网站的访问体验并提高其运营效率和服务质量。